Output f8d7aff8b9753dc10ae207fc59ccf8fb220c132e54d4622d87101528cb2aa76b:2

value
666994
script pubkey
OP_0 OP_PUSHBYTES_20 8d32b22656271b790ae61411204859a38e34f187
address
bc1q35etyfjkyudhjzhxzsgjqjze5w8rfuv8sm8cpj
transaction
f8d7aff8b9753dc10ae207fc59ccf8fb220c132e54d4622d87101528cb2aa76b